Planning appeal decision

Dismissed3 June 20253361667

2 Kingscote Road East, Cheltenham, Gloucestershire, GL51 6JS

proposed dormer roof extension to existing garage to convert into ancillary bedroom accommodation

Authority
Cheltenham Borough Council
Appeal type
householder · Householder (HAS)
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Householder developments
Inspector
Jones GP

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• The effects of the proposals on the character and appearance of its surroundings
  • The effects of the proposals on the living conditions of the neighbouring residents at 17 Wards Road with reference to privacy

What decided it

The poor design and incongruous appearance of the proposed dormers in a prominent street location, combined with the unacceptable loss of privacy to the neighbouring property, meant the development conflicted with both character and amenity policies.

Plan policies cited: Policy D1 of the Cheltenham Plan, Policy SD4 of the Gloucester, Cheltenham and Tewkesbury Joint Core Strategy, Policy SL1 of the Cheltenham Plan, Policy SD14 of the Gloucester, Cheltenham and Tewkesbury Joint Core Strategy
